JAMMU:  Traffic Police City has realized a fine of Rs. 1.5 crore from the violators and about 86239 vehicles have been challaned besides 1600 vehicles have been seized during the last six months.

Acting on the complaints from general public against commercial vehicles especially Matadors/Mini Buses, Traffic Police launched special drives during which about 21693 vehicles Matadors-Mini Buses have been challaned and revenue of Rs.3988850 has been realized as fine from the violators. Similarly, 26229 Motor bikes have been challaned and fine of aboutRs. 3807490 has been realized from them.

 Traffic Police City Jammu has made strenuous efforts to curb the menace of traffic violation especially in visible offences. Besides awareness campaigns have been launched to educate the public about the traffic rules especially among the school going children in order to check accidents.
